Leaders who were most effective about bringing about change were also
willing to challenge those who do not fully support the change effort.
When David Kearns was attempting to introduce a company-wide quality
initiative, two vice presidents remained carping critics of the program. Both
had been good performers in their roles, but Kearns constantly admonished
them to get on board. By not doing anything about these two dissidents,
Kearns would have sent the message that the quality change initiative was not
that important. He terminated them both and let the organization know that
it was because of their nonsupport of the quality initiative.
How Do You Get Leaders to Be the Antenna to the Outside World?
One key differentiating behavior that distinguished extraordinary leaders was
their ability to connect their organization to the outside world. As technology
and innovation affect every aspect of an organization, having a vision for what
is going on outside one’s own organization is critical for every successful
leader. Our analysis of competency companions for connecting to the outside
world found that a strong companion behavior was having a broad focus and
perspective.
One of the fascinating aspects of graduate education is that most graduate
programs continually narrow the focus of one’s study. An early indication that
a person has succeeded in life is that he has mastered a specific field. Individ-
ual contributors learn quickly that a key to success is oftentimes to narrow one’s
focus and become an expert in something. Many early experiences in a per-
son’s career reinforce that idea. What was helpful at one point in a career, how-
ever, frequently becomes an obstacle as people are promoted to leadership
positions that require broader responsibility and perspective. With a narrow
perspective, attempting to connect to the outside world is like looking at the
world through long tubes that only allow you to see a limited part of the world.
A broader perspective helps leaders to recognize the interrelationships among
various events and their impacts on technology, society, and government.
